
(ANSA-AFP) - FRANKFURT AM MAIN, NOV 11 - Investor morale in Germany in November fell slightly, despite expectations for a slight increase, according to a survey from the ZEW institute. It showed that market expectations for the economy dipped to 38.5 points, from 39.3 a month earlier. "The overall mood is characterised by a fall in confidence in the capacity of Germany's economic policy to tackle the pressing issues," said ZEW president Achim Wambach. (ANSA-AFP).
